Re: 1g 6 bolt 4g63 tsi build

Quote:
Originally Posted by goodhart View Post
Why the line from tank to rail?
Since I've started driving the car there has always been a fuel smell but no major fuel leaks. I finally got around to fixing it, it turned out I had a few issues. The sending unit had no gasket and half the studs on top are broken off. Also, the hose section was seeping at the crimps. I decided to just replace it all and make it look better too.

Re: 1g 6 bolt 4g63 tsi build

Install of the EGT gauge and sensor was a breeze thanks to a previously tapped manifold I bought from Carltalon a few months back. The fuel pressure gauge install went well too, except it reads 10psi high. I contacted prosport and ill be measuring the resistance of the sensor tomorrow to test it. I like the how the gauges are either white (daytime), or blue (nighttime). I wired them so they come on white, I hit the fog light switch to change to blue.
